National Guard is controlled by individual states state governor is the commander in chief president still has the power to activate the National Guard and bring it under federal control in times of emergency natural disasters wars etc. Most of the time its under the control of individual states with the state governor acting as commander in chief. The history of the Army National Guard in the United States dates from 1636 when the Massachusetts Bay Colonys government organized existing militia companies into three regiments. The main difference between Army Reserve and National Guard is Army reserve is directly under the command of federal services whereas the National Guard comes under the state government.

National Guard Described as a joint activity of the Department of Defense between the Army and Air Force both Army and Air Force Guard operations fall under the jurisdiction of state governors but can also operate under Federal authorization when conditions warrant. Fanta was indeed invented in Germany during WW II because the Coca Cola Company lacked basic materials to produce Coke but the original Fanta was made from old apples and pears as well as whey. American Fanta is a much darker colour or color if you must sweeter smoother and considerably less fizzy whereas in the UK its a much tangier fizzier paler affair. The real and perceptible flavor differences are due to the inclusion of actual fruit juice in some of the European iterations and the fact that Europeans tend to like a slightly lower sweetness level.
